What to Expect from Gulf Conditions

The Gulf of Mexico often serves as a breeding ground for storms due to its warm waters. Meteorologists are particularly vigilant during this time of year as tropical systems can form rapidly. The National Hurricane Center is advising residents in coastal regions to remain updated on potential warnings and to prepare emergency plans.
